About this product
This self-adhesive draught shield tape with flex-flap technology seals gaps around windows and doors instantly. You're looking at a simple solution that stops draughts and cuts heating costs. One side sticks firmly to frames while the flexible flap bridges gaps. The seal stays weatherproof and airtight but lets you open doors and windows easily. It works on shower screens too where you need a flexible seal. Just measure, cut, peel and stick it in place within seconds.
JML Navy Seal Draught Shield Tape features flex-flap technology that creates an instant seal without blocking movement. The self-adhesive strip fixes along edges and frames while the non-adhesive flap side bridges gaps effectively. It's suitable for windows, doors and shower screens in both opening directions. You'll reduce heating bills by keeping cold air out where it matters. The tape is simple to apply with no special tools needed. There's peace of mind knowing you've sealed draughts quickly and effectively.

Customers Say
The product effectively stops drafts and is easy to apply, but many users report poor adhesive quality causing it to peel or fall off quickly, requiring extra glue or tape for better hold.
